
Worked on the openshift/hypershift and openshift/release repositories to deliver cross-cloud Google Cloud Platform (GCP) support, focusing on API and CLI development, IAM integration, and CI/CD automation. Built features enabling GCP-hosted cluster lifecycle management, secure IAM provisioning with Workload Identity Federation, and storage service account integration for persistent disk operations. Leveraged Go and YAML for backend and configuration work, implementing robust validation, reconciliation logic, and comprehensive end-to-end testing. Established CI quality gates for the gcp-hcp-ctl CLI using Kubernetes-native tools. The work improved multi-cloud automation, enhanced security, and standardized cluster provisioning and deprovisioning workflows across cloud environments.
May 2026 — Openshift/release: Delivered CI/Quality Gate setup for gcp-hcp-ctl CLI, introducing CI Operator configurations, Prow/Tide, and generated presubmit jobs to enforce unit tests and linting before merges. This standardizes CI for the gcp-hcp-ctl repo, aligning with the openshift-online/gcp-hcp-infra template. Commit 7becb35c79d86dd2c7b69efdfc148c4e117b6a90 added the configuration and presubmit jobs.
May 2026 — Openshift/release: Delivered CI/Quality Gate setup for gcp-hcp-ctl CLI, introducing CI Operator configurations, Prow/Tide, and generated presubmit jobs to enforce unit tests and linting before merges. This standardizes CI for the gcp-hcp-ctl repo, aligning with the openshift-online/gcp-hcp-infra template. Commit 7becb35c79d86dd2c7b69efdfc148c4e117b6a90 added the configuration and presubmit jobs.
February 2026 monthly summary for openshift/hypershift focusing on GCP PD CSI Driver storage service account integration. Delivered API and CLI support for a Storage Service Account, updated HostedCluster to include GCPServiceAccountsEmails with validation, and implemented credential reconciliation in the hosted cluster controller. Also added CLI flag for cluster creation to pass the storage service account, regenerated CRDs/docs/vendor, and expanded e2e tests with new helpers to cover the storage service account workflow. This work enhances IAM-based security, simplifies provisioning, and improves reliability of GCP PD disk operations across clusters.
February 2026 monthly summary for openshift/hypershift focusing on GCP PD CSI Driver storage service account integration. Delivered API and CLI support for a Storage Service Account, updated HostedCluster to include GCPServiceAccountsEmails with validation, and implemented credential reconciliation in the hosted cluster controller. Also added CLI flag for cluster creation to pass the storage service account, regenerated CRDs/docs/vendor, and expanded e2e tests with new helpers to cover the storage service account workflow. This work enhances IAM-based security, simplifies provisioning, and improves reliability of GCP PD disk operations across clusters.
December 2025 highlights for openshift/hypershift: Delivered two significant GCP IAM enhancements that strengthen security, reduce toil, and improve cluster lifecycle hygiene. Implemented Google Cloud Workload Identity Federation credentials support in the Control Plane operator to enable secure, streamlined IAM for GCP workloads, including CPO credentials secret creation, ReconcileCredentials enhancements to cover both NodePool and ControlPlane, service account email validation, and deployment configuration updates. Added a robust destroy IAM infrastructure command to cleanly remove GCP IAM resources (workload identity pool, OIDC provider, service accounts and bindings) to support safe deprovisioning and cost/security hygiene. These changes were complemented by unit tests and formatting helpers. Together, they improve security posture, simplify IAM management, and reduce operational risk when scaling or decommissioning HyperShift clusters.
December 2025 highlights for openshift/hypershift: Delivered two significant GCP IAM enhancements that strengthen security, reduce toil, and improve cluster lifecycle hygiene. Implemented Google Cloud Workload Identity Federation credentials support in the Control Plane operator to enable secure, streamlined IAM for GCP workloads, including CPO credentials secret creation, ReconcileCredentials enhancements to cover both NodePool and ControlPlane, service account email validation, and deployment configuration updates. Added a robust destroy IAM infrastructure command to cleanly remove GCP IAM resources (workload identity pool, OIDC provider, service accounts and bindings) to support safe deprovisioning and cost/security hygiene. These changes were complemented by unit tests and formatting helpers. Together, they improve security posture, simplify IAM management, and reduce operational risk when scaling or decommissioning HyperShift clusters.
November 2025: Delivered cross-cloud GCP support via the hypershift CLI and comprehensive IAM infrastructure for Workload Identity Federation (WIF) enabling secure, automated GCP-hosted HyperShift clusters. Implemented GCP HostedCluster lifecycle management, GCP IAM provisioning, and robust CLI integration with validation, timeout handling, and extensive testing. Result: accelerated multi-cloud cluster provisioning, improved security posture, and stronger automation for GCP-hosted HyperShift deployments.
November 2025: Delivered cross-cloud GCP support via the hypershift CLI and comprehensive IAM infrastructure for Workload Identity Federation (WIF) enabling secure, automated GCP-hosted HyperShift clusters. Implemented GCP HostedCluster lifecycle management, GCP IAM provisioning, and robust CLI integration with validation, timeout handling, and extensive testing. Result: accelerated multi-cloud cluster provisioning, improved security posture, and stronger automation for GCP-hosted HyperShift deployments.
October 2025 monthly delivery focused on extending cross-cloud support by adding initial Google Cloud Platform (GCP) support for the HostedCluster API in the hypershift repository. The work enables GCP-based hosted clusters and lays groundwork for broader cloud-provider integrations. Key design changes include a new GCPPlatformSpec for configuring GCP project ID and region, and an updated PlatformType enum to include GCP. Changes are gated behind the GCPPlatform feature flag to support controlled rollout and future config expansion.
October 2025 monthly delivery focused on extending cross-cloud support by adding initial Google Cloud Platform (GCP) support for the HostedCluster API in the hypershift repository. The work enables GCP-based hosted clusters and lays groundwork for broader cloud-provider integrations. Key design changes include a new GCPPlatformSpec for configuring GCP project ID and region, and an updated PlatformType enum to include GCP. Changes are gated behind the GCPPlatform feature flag to support controlled rollout and future config expansion.

Overview of all repositories you've contributed to across your timeline